Security guard killed in heist
2005-07-29 14:18
Johannesburg - A security guard was killed and four others injured in a cash heist on the N3 near Leondale on Friday morning, East Rand police said.
A gang of ten robbers used two cars and a bakkie to force an SBV transit van off the road at 08:30, said superintendent Andy Pieke.
The van overturned and the robbers opened fire with AK47 and R5 rifles. One of the guards was shot in the head and died on the scene.
The robbers then used an axe to force open the van and remove the cash.
The gang escaped in a Nissan bakkie and a white BMW, leaving another white BMW - stolen in Edenvale last month - at the scene.
The other BMW was recovered later.
Four other security guards were in hospital with injuries, but it was not known whether they had been shot or injured in the collision.
